    upgrading my OS

    ok i just got windows millenium edition. i have windows98. if i upgrade, will i lose all the files i have on my computer? i want windows 2000, but i don't want to have to reinstall everything...

    If you already have Win98SE, keep it. Don't install ME. If you do install ME, you're best off saving your stuff, wipe the drive, and do a clean install. Installing the upgrade on top of an existing OS is bad juju... usually not a good idea.

                Just a little story I like to tell people who are thinking of using WinME.

                All the employees at CompUSA (sales and tech) got free advance copies of WinME so they would know what they were talking about when it came out. I'd say around 75% of the store installed it that week.

                A week later they were all back to their previous OS and the store didn't sell much WinME because all the salespeople hated it.

                I've heard more people have problems with WinME.. Its not touching my computer.

                        ME juss has to many precautions and backs up important system stuff behind ur back a lot - causing CPU cycles to be taken up - and its still a new OS and has many bugs - also makes me feel like a dumbass with all its help features poppin up left and right, lol. Personally, if u are a MS user, i'd recommend Win2K Pro, its soo stable and juss runs 10x better than the others - the NTFS is more secure as well. 98SE is a little bit better if u run a lot of games tho, (if u only play a few of the major games like Q3, UT, DII, or HL - then u should be fine wit 2K). For the ones who are more technically inclined Redhat Linux and Slackware are great ....
